一种网络诊断方法和装置被公开。第一通信节点的操作方法包括:基于在通信节点之间发送的第一消息和响应于所述第一消息的第一响应消息来检查和第一通信节点连接的通信节点中的每一个是否处于故障状态,并且生成诊断响应消息,所述诊断响应消息包括处于故障状态或正常状态的通信节点的识别信息。因此,网络性能可被增强。
【技术实现步骤摘要】
本专利技术的示例实施例总体涉及网络诊断技术并且更特别地涉及一种方法和装置,用于诊断组成网络的通信节点的状态和通信节点所连接的信道(或端口)的状态。
技术介绍
随着车辆部件的快速数字化,安装于车辆的电子设备的数量和类型显著增加。电子设备可广泛用于动力总成控制系统,车身控制系统,底盘控制系统,车载网络,多媒体系统等。动力总成控制系统可表示引擎控制系统,自动传输控制系统等。车身控制系统可表示车身电子装置控制系统,便携装置控制系统,灯泡控制系统等。底盘控制系统可表示转向装置控制系统,制动控制系统,悬架控制系统等。车载网络可表示控制器区域网络(CAN),基于FlexRay的网络,媒体导向系统传输(MOST)的网络等。多媒体系统可表示导航装置系统、远程信息处理系统、信息娱乐系统等。系统和组成每个系统的电子设备通过车载网络连接,其为支持电子设备的功能所必需。CAN可支持高达1Mbps的传输速率并可支持冲突消息的自动重新传输,基于循环冗余接口(CRC)的误差检测等。基于FlexRay的网络可支持高达10Mbps的传输速率并可支持通过两个信道的数据同时传输,同步数据传输等。基于MOST的网络为用于高质量多媒体的通信网络,其可支持高达150Mbps的传输速率。同时,车辆的远程信息处理系统,信息娱乐系统和增强安全系统需要高传输速率和系统可扩展性。然而,CAN,基于FlexRay的网络等,可能不充分支持需求。基于MOST的网络可支持比CAN和基于FlexRay的网络更高的传输速率。然而,其花费较大的代价来应用基于MOST的网络至所有车载网络。由于该限制,基于以太网的网络可考虑作为车载网络。基于以太网的网络可通过一对线圈支持双向通信并可支持高达10Gbps的传输速率。基于以太网的车载网络可包括复数个通信节点。因此,需要一种方法,用
于诊断每一个通信节点的状态(即,正常状态或故障状态)和通信节点所连接的信道(或端口)的状态。
技术实现思路
因此,本专利技术的示例实施例被提供以实质上避免由于相关技术的限制和缺点的一个或多个问题。本专利技术的示例实施例提供了一种方法,用于诊断组成网络的通信节点的状态和该通信节点所连接的信道(或端口)的状态。本专利技术的示例实施例还提供了一种装置,用于诊断组成网络的通信节点的状态和该通信节点所连接的信道(或端口)的状态。在某些示例实施例,第一通信节点的操作方法包括:基于在通信节点之间发送的第一消息和响应于所述第一消息的第一响应消息,检查和所述第一通信节点连接的通信节点中的每个是否处于故障状态;以及生成诊断响应消息,所述诊断响应消息包括处于故障状态或正常状态的通信节点的识别信息。这里,第一消息可为网络管理(NM)消息。这里,当响应于所述第一消息的第一响应消息在预定义时间段内未被收到时,第一通信节点确定从中将要发送第一响应消息的通信节点处于故障状态。这里,第一通信节点为开关或桥,并且和所述第一通信节点连接通信节点中的每个为终端节点。这里,该识别信息可为互联网协议(IP)地址,端口号和媒体访问控制(MAC)地址的至少一个。这里,当从车载诊断(OBD)设备接收到诊断请求消息时,所述诊断响应消息被生成。这里,第一消息,第一响应消息,该诊断请求消息以及诊断响应消息的每一个可为基于以太网协议生成的消息。此外,该操作方法还包括发送诊断响应消息至OBD设备。这里,该诊断响应消息可以广播的方式发送。在其它示例实施例,第一通信节点的操作方法包括:发送第一消息至和第一通信节点连接的至少一个通信节点;基于响应于所述第一消息的第一响应消息的接收状态来检查和第一通信节点连接的至少一个通信节点是否处于故障状态;以及生成诊断响应消息,所述诊断响应消息包括处于故障状态或正常状态
的通信节点的识别信息。这里,当响应于所述第一消息的第一响应消息在预定义时间段内未被收到时,第一通信节点确定从中将要发送第一响应消息的通信节点处于故障状态。这里,第一通信节点可为开关或桥,并且和第一通信节点连接的至少一个通信节点为终端节点。这里,该识别信息可为IP地址,端口号和MAC地址的至少一个。这里,车载诊断(OBD)设备接收诊断请求消息时,该诊断响应消息被生成。这里,第一消息,第一响应消息,该诊断请求消息和该诊断响应消息的每一个可为基于以太网协议生成的消息。此外,该操作方法可进一步包括发送该诊断响应消息至OBD设备。在另一其他示例实施例,车载诊断设备的操作方法包括:发送诊断请求消息至第一通信节点;以及从第一通信节点接收诊断响应消息,所述诊断响应消息包括和第一通信节点连接的至少一个通信节点中的处于故障状态或正常状态的通信节点的识别信息。这里,第一通信节点为开关或桥,并且和第一通信节点连接的至少一个通信节点为终端节点。这里,诊断请求消息和诊断响应消息的每一个可为基于以太网协议生成的消息。这里,该识别信息可为IP地址,端口号和MAC地址的至少一个。附图说明本专利技术的示例实施例将通过详细描述本专利技术的示例实施例并参考附图而变得更加显而易见,其中:图1为框图,示出根据一个实施例的车载网络拓扑;图2为框图,示出根据一个实施例的组成车载网络的通信节点;图3为框图,用于描述根据一个实施例的方法,用于利用车载诊断(OBD)设备诊断车载网络;图4为框图,用于描述根据另一实施例的方法,用于利用OBD设备诊断车载网络;图5为序列图,示出根据本专利技术实施例的网络诊断方法;图6为序列图,示出根据本专利技术的另一实施例的网络诊断方法;以及图7为框图,示出用于基于以太网的车载网络的消息的示例。具体实施方式由于本专利技术可以多种形式修改并且具有若干示例性实施例,特定示例性实施例将在附图示出并且在详细描述中被详细地描述。然而,应当理解,其并非意图将本专利技术限制在具体实施例,相反,本专利技术意在涵盖处于本专利技术精神和范围内的所有修改以及可选项。关系项诸如第一,第二等可用于描述多种元素,但该元素不应当被项所限制。该项仅用于区分一个元素和另一个元素。例如,第一组件可命名为第二组件而不偏离本专利技术范围,而第二组件还可类似地命名为第一组件。术语“和/或”表示任一个或复数个相关和所描述项的组合。当提到特定组件“耦合于”或“连接于”另一组件时,应当理解特定组件直接“耦合于”或“连接于”其它组件或进一步地,组件可位于其之间。相反,当提到特定组件“直接耦合于”或“直接连接于”另一组件时,应当理解,进一步组件并非位于其之间。在如下描述中,技术术语仅用于说明特定示例性实施例而非限制本公开。单数形式“一个(a)”,“一个(an)”,以及“这个(the)”包括复数引用。除非上下文另有明确表示。在本说明书中,应当理解,术语“具有”,“包含”,“包括”等用于指定声明特征,整数,步骤,操作,元素和/或组件的存在,但不排除一个或多个其他特征,整数,步骤,操作,元素,组件和/或其组合的存在或附加。除非另有定义,本文使用的所有术语(包括技术和科学术语)具有与本专利技术所属领域的普通技术人员通常理解相同的含义。术语,诸如通用并且已在字典中的术语,应当被解释为具有匹配于本领域上下文含义的含义。在该描述中,除非清晰地定义,术语并不在理论上过分解释为正式含义。在下文中,优选的本专利技术的实施例将参考附图详细描述。在所描述的专利技术中,为实现本专利技术的全面本文档来自技高网...
【技术保护点】
一种组成网络的第一通信节点的操作方法,所述操作方法包括以下步骤:基于在通信节点之间发送的第一消息和响应于所述第一消息的第一响应消息,检查和所述第一通信节点连接的通信节点中的每个是否处于故障状态;以及生成诊断响应消息,所述诊断响应消息包括处于故障状态或正常状态的通信节点的识别信息。
【技术特征摘要】
2015.07.13 KR 10-2015-0098909;2014.07.18 US 62/0261.一种组成网络的第一通信节点的操作方法,所述操作方法包括以下步骤:基于在通信节点之间发送的第一消息和响应于所述第一消息的第一响应消息,检查和所述第一通信节点连接的通信节点中的每个是否处于故障状态;以及生成诊断响应消息,所述诊断响应消息包括处于故障状态或正常状态的通信节点的识别信息。2.根据权利要求1所述的操作方法,其中第一消息为网络管理(NM)消息。3.根据权利要求1所述的操作方法,其中,当响应于所述第一消息的第一响应消息在预定义时间段内未被收到时,第一通信节点确定从中将要发送第一响应消息的通信节点处于故障状态。4.根据权利要求1所述的操作方法,其中第一通信节点为开关或桥,并且和所述第一通信节点连接通信节点中的每个为终端节点。5.根据权利要求1所述的操作方法,其中所述识别信息为互联网协议(IP)地址、端口号和媒体访问控制(MAC)地址中的至少一个。6.根据权利要求1所述的操作方法,其中当从车载诊断(OBD)设备接收到诊断请求消息时,所述诊断响应消息被生成。7.根据权利要求6所述的操作方法,其中第一消息、第一响应消息、诊断请求消息和诊断响应消息中的每一个为基于以太网协议生成的消息。8.根据权利要求1所述的操作方法,还包括将所述诊断响应消息发送至车载诊断(OBD)设备。9.根据权利要求8所述的操作方法,其中所述诊断响应消息以广播的方式发送。10.一种组成网络的第一通信节点的操作方法,所述操作方法包括以下步骤:发送第一消息至和第一通信节点连接的至少一个通信节点;基于响应于所述第一...
【专利技术属性】
技术研发人员:金东玉,徐纲云,蔡寯秉,尹真桦,柳相宇,
申请(专利权)人:现代自动车株式会社,
类型:发明
国别省市:韩国;KR
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。